1st completed project in a long time: BNSF 7695

Pretty excited to finally be finished with my first major project in many years. This is a friend's Tower 55 ES44DC that I repainted from NP "fantasty" colors to BNSF H3/Swoosh. We chose the experimental yellow-lettered 7695 since we figured T55 would be releasing the standard H3/Swoosh scheme, and if I was going to custom paint it it might as well be something you just can't buy. That and I like the yellow lettering, and think the BNSF should have stuck with it. Lesson learned here: never repaint an already painted & assembled (grab irons and such) model, always start with new, undecorated, and unassembled!
